COA (Certificate of Analysis)

What is COA ?

A Certificate of Analysis (COA) in a QC microbiology lab is an official document that confirms a batch of raw material, finished product, or culture medium has been tested and meets all safety and quality specifications.

What it includes

Sample Details: Batch/lot number, manufacturing date, and expiry date.

Test Parameters & Limits: Tests like Total Aerobic Count (TAMC), Yeast & Mold (TYMC), and pathogen screening (E. coli, Salmonella, S. aureus).

Observed Results: Exact colony counts (CFU/g) or qualitative outcomes (“Absent” / “Complies”).

Sign-off: Final approval signatures from QC and QA teams certifying the batch is safe to release.

In short, a COA acts as the official “pass certificate” for regulatory compliance and product safety before distribution.
